Lucy Knisley Illustrates Her Breakup

I admit, I've been silently cursing Lucy Knisley for going so long without updating her webcomic. I realize my impatience isn't fair; Knisley's dealing with a rough breakup and a consequential move, but I need my brain crack, dammit.

Earlier this week, it finally occurred to me to scoot on over to Knisley's LiveJournal to see if she'd left any breadcrumbs there. To my surprise and delight, I saw that not only has Knisley been busy cartooning, she's got a 25-page comic available for digital download. Score!

 "Salvaged Parts" is a set of short pieces about Knisley's recent upheaval centered around a handful of objects -- a bedframe, a bicycle, a skateboard, and an unusual family heirloom. It's a neat complement to the essays at Stop Paying Attention, and at $2, it's well worth the price if you've been jonesing for more Knisley.
